Controversial Tweet Costs Gary Lineker BBC Job and 2026 World Cup Hosting Gig
Match of the Day host and footballing legend Gary Lineker's outspoken tweet criticizing the UK government's asylum policy has cost him his BBC job – and potentially, his role in hosting the 2026 World Cup. The fallout from the seemingly innocuous social media post has ignited a firestorm of debate surrounding freedom of speech, impartiality in broadcasting, and the complexities of navigating public opinion in the digital age.
The controversy began with a tweet by Lineker, comparing the language used to launch the government's new asylum policy to that of 1930s Germany. This sparked immediate outrage from government officials and a significant portion of the public, who accused him of trivializing the Holocaust and displaying unacceptable bias. While Lineker later clarified his intentions, emphasizing his opposition to the policy itself rather than any direct comparison to the Nazi regime, the damage was done.
BBC's Response and the Fallout
The BBC, under immense pressure, initially suspended Lineker from his presenting duties on Match of the Day, sparking a chain reaction that saw several prominent presenters and commentators withdraw in solidarity. This resulted in significantly altered programming, with the flagship sports show airing in a drastically shortened and altered format for several days. The BBC's response, criticized by many as heavy-handed, fueled the debate on the balance between journalistic freedom and corporate responsibility. The ensuing disruption significantly impacted viewership and highlighted the vulnerability of established media outlets to public and political pressure in the age of social media.
